WordPress sites face constant automated attacks targeting xmlrpc.php for brute force amplification, wp-login.php for credential theft, and vulnerable plugins for remote code execution. Over 90% of CMS-based attacks specifically target WordPress installations.
Zero trust eliminates implicit trust based on network location. Every access request is verified regardless of source, minimizing the impact of compromised credentials or network breaches. Implementation requires strong identity verification and continuous authorization.
